运行weka程序时可能会报如下错误
---Registering Weka Editors---
Trying to add database driver (JDBC): RmiJdbc.RJDriver - Error, not in CLASSPATH?
Trying to add database driver (JDBC): jdbc.idbDriver - Error, not in CLASSPATH?
Trying to add database driver (JDBC): org.gjt.mm.mysql.Driver - Error, not in CLASSPATH?
Trying to add database driver (JDBC): com.mckoi.JDBCDriver - Error, not in CLASSPATH?
Trying to add database driver (JDBC): org.hsqldb.jdbcDriver - Error, not in CLASSPATH?
实际上,这些事warnings
而不是errors
,对于常见的数据库,系统有默认的连接设置,因为,程序运行前,weka会做一个快速的检查,检查这个数据库的驱动driver
是否available
,如MySQL、Hypersonic、Instantdb
等,然后这些信息会被安全的忽略掉
解决方法
1.若未用到数据库,直接忽略,程序正常运行
2.下载对应的jar包放在java\jre\lib\ext
目录下即可